KIN 5430 - The History and Philosophy of Physical Education

Institution:
Utah State University
Subject:
Kinesiology
Description:
Designed to familiarize physical education majors (or nonmajors) with history of physical education and sport, as well as philosophical influences which have contributed to development of contemporary physical education and sport. Considers historical development of yesterday's pastimes into today's complex, institutionalized forms of sport and physical education.
